10 Signs You're Studying for a PhD in Fluid Dynamics

  1. Morning Coffee Calculations: You no longer merely pour your morning coffee. Instead, you find yourself casually estimating the Reynolds number of the flow, noting the laminar and turbulent phases, and contemplating the intricate dance of fluid particles in your mug.
  2. Bathtub Theories: Taking a bath isn't relaxing anymore. It's an experiment. You're intrigued by the vortex formed when the water drains and have, on occasion, tried to model it on your laptop—while ensuring the device is safely away from the water, of course.
  3. Fluid Puns: Your sense of humor has taken a peculiar turn. You've chuckled at jokes like: "Why did the fluid dynamicist break up with the statistician? Too much turbulence in their relationship."
  4. Wind Rants: A breezy day isn’t just a breezy day. It’s an opportunity to rant about boundary layers, drag coefficients, and that latest computational model you're trying to perfect for capturing the nuances of air flow around objects.
  5. Seeing the World in Navier-Stokes: While others might admire the beauty of a waterfall, you’re busy visualizing the Navier-Stokes equations and wondering about the pressure distribution at the base. Romantic dates by the riverbank now come with a side of science.
  6. Fluid Fashion: Your wardrobe inadvertently flaunts shirts with patterns resembling flow visualizations. And yes, you do have that one T-shirt with "Keep Calm and Solve for Vorticity" printed on it.
  7. Dreams of Dimensionless Numbers: Last night, you dreamt you were being chased by a giant dimensionless number. It was a real nightmare—until you realized you could escape by changing the scale.
  8. Kitchen Experiments: Cooking dinner is no longer straightforward. Whisking eggs becomes an observation in shear-thinning, and observing oil in a pan is your casual Rayleigh-Taylor instability experiment.
  9. Your Reaction to Straws: You can't use a straw without getting into a deep discussion about laminar flow, viscous effects, and how the radius affects the speed of your drink reaching your mouth. Friends hesitate to hand you a beverage with a straw in it.
  10. Fluid Dynamics Film Critique: Watching movies becomes an exercise in fluid critique. While everyone is focused on the plot, you're questioning the accuracy of that CGI waterfall or wondering why the depiction of space doesn’t account for the interstellar medium's subtle effects.
